Fast-growing flowers can go from seed to flower in as little as 50 days. Popular, rapid bloomers … derived constructorWebHow plants grow. Most plants grow from seeds. For months or even years a seed may remain dormant (inactive). Inside the seed is an embryo: the basic parts from which a young plant, or seedling, develops. The seed also contains food to keep the embryo alive.
